When \[\ce{Cu^2+}\] ion is treated with \[\ce{KI}\], a white precipitate is formed. Explain the reaction with the help of chemical equation.
Advertisements
उत्तर
Reduction of \[\ce{Cu^2+}\] to \[\ce{Cu^+}\] takes place due to reaction with F ions.
This is given by the equation.
\[\ce{2Cu^2+ + 4I^- -> \underset{(White precipitate)}{Cu2I2 + I2}}\]
